Tag: Imposter Syndrome

  • Ways to Overcome Imposter Syndrome and Embrace Your Passion for Programming

    Blog Post Title: Overcoming Imposter Syndrome and Embracing Your Passion for Programming

    Summary:

    Imposter syndrome is a psychological pattern where individuals doubt their accomplishments and fear being exposed as a fraud. This is a common struggle for many programmers, as the field is constantly evolving and there is always more to learn. It can lead to feelings of inadequacy and self-doubt, which can hold back one’s potential and passion for programming.

    However, there are ways to overcome imposter syndrome and embrace your passion for programming. In this blog post, we will discuss some practical tips and strategies to help you conquer these feelings and reach your full potential as a programmer.

    1. Acknowledge and Understand Imposter Syndrome

    The first step in overcoming imposter syndrome is to acknowledge that it exists and understand what it is. Many people experience these feelings, even successful programmers, so know that you are not alone. Imposter syndrome can manifest in various ways, such as feeling like you don’t belong in the programming world or that your skills are not good enough.

    By understanding what imposter syndrome is and how it affects you, you can start to identify when these feelings arise and take steps to combat them.

    2. Celebrate Your Accomplishments

    Often, those experiencing imposter syndrome tend to downplay their achievements and focus on their mistakes or shortcomings. It’s essential to celebrate your accomplishments, no matter how big or small they may seem. Keep a record of your successes, whether it’s completing a challenging project or receiving positive feedback from a colleague or client.

    Take the time to reflect on your accomplishments and give yourself credit where it is due. This can help boost your confidence and remind you of your skills and abilities.

    3. Learn from Your Mistakes

    As a programmer, it’s inevitable to make mistakes and encounter setbacks. However, instead of letting these mistakes reinforce your imposter syndrome, use them as learning opportunities. Reflect on what went wrong and how you can improve in the future. This mindset shift can help you see mistakes as a natural part of the learning process and not a reflection of your abilities.

    4. Seek Support and Mentorship

    realistic humanoid robot with a sleek design and visible mechanical joints against a dark background

    Ways to Overcome Imposter Syndrome and Embrace Your Passion for Programming

    Talking to others who have experienced imposter syndrome can be incredibly helpful in overcoming it. Reach out to colleagues, friends, or mentors who can provide support and share their own experiences. Having a supportive network can help you realize that these feelings are common and that others have overcome them.

    Additionally, having a mentor in the programming field can provide valuable guidance and advice as you navigate your career. They can also offer a different perspective on your skills and abilities, which can help combat imposter syndrome.

    5. Continuously Learn and Grow

    One of the best ways to overcome imposter syndrome is to continuously learn and improve your skills. The field of programming is constantly evolving, so staying updated on new technologies and techniques is crucial. This can help you feel more confident in your abilities and showcase your passion for programming.

    Take advantage of online courses, workshops, and conferences to expand your knowledge and skills. This not only benefits your career but also helps combat imposter syndrome by reminding you of your progress and growth.

    6. Embrace Your Uniqueness

    Imposter syndrome can make you feel like you need to fit into a particular mold to be a successful programmer. However, it’s essential to embrace your uniqueness and use it to your advantage. Everyone has their strengths and weaknesses, and that’s what makes us all different.

    Instead of trying to compare yourself to others, focus on your strengths and how you can use them in your programming journey. Embrace your unique perspective and experiences, as they can bring a valuable and fresh perspective to your work.

    In conclusion, imposter syndrome is a common struggle for many programmers, but it does not have to hold you back from embracing your passion for programming. By acknowledging and understanding it, celebrating your accomplishments, learning from your mistakes, seeking support, continuously learning, and embracing your uniqueness, you can overcome imposter syndrome and reach your full potential as a programmer.

    Current Event:

    A current event that relates to this topic is the recent news of Google’s CEO Sundar Pichai announcing a new initiative to address imposter syndrome in the tech industry. This initiative, called “Google Career Certificates,” aims to provide training and certification programs for individuals without college degrees to enter high-demand tech jobs. It also includes a “Grow with Google” program, offering free training and tools to help individuals gain the skills needed for tech jobs.

    Pichai stated that “we need new, accessible job-training solutions-from enhanced vocational programs to online education-to help America recover and rebuild.” This initiative is a step towards addressing imposter syndrome, as it provides opportunities for individuals who may feel like they don’t belong in the tech industry due to their lack of a traditional degree.

    Source: https://www.forbes.com/sites/alexandrasternlicht/2020/07/14/google-launches-new-initiative-to-combat-imposter-syndrome-in-the-tech-industry/?sh=6e1d54e66a8e